不能直接做专业前端,但可以通过技能拓展实现转型。Java培训主要培养后端开发能力,与前端技术栈存在明显差异。不过掌握Java后,通过补充HTML、CSS、Javascript等前端技术,完全可以向全栈工程师发展,这是当前市场最抢手的技术人才方向之一。

Java与前端技术栈的本质区别
Java培训课程体系以服务端开发为核心,重点学习Spring Boot、数据库操作、接口设计等后端技能。而专业前端开发需要精通三大核心技术:HTML负责页面结构,CSS负责样式设计,Javascript负责交互逻辑。两者在知识体系、工具链、开发思维上都有显著差异。
Java开发者转型前端的可行路径
对于Java学员来说,转型前端并非从零开始。首先,Java开发者通常具备扎实的编程基础和逻辑思维能力,这是学习任何编程语言的共同优势。建议分三步走:
- 第一阶段:掌握基础三件套(HTML/CSS/JS),完成简单静态页面开发
- 第二阶段:学习主流前端框架(Vue/React),掌握组件化开发思想
- 第三阶段:结合Java后端知识,开发完整全栈项目,实现前后端联调
市场对全栈人才的需求分析
当前企业招聘中,全栈工程师薪资普遍比纯后端或纯前端高15%-25%。一线城市大厂更倾向于招聘具备前后端能力的复合型人才,而二三线城市中小企业则急需能够独立负责完整项目的开发者。Java背景的全栈工程师在电商、金融、企业服务等领域尤其吃香。
学习建议与避坑指南
切勿在Java基础不牢时盲目转向前端。建议先扎实掌握Java核心技能,再利用业余时间系统学习前端技术。市场上很多机构鼓吹"三个月全栈速成",实际上真正的全栈能力需要1-2年的项目积累。选择培训机构时,要重点考察其课程是否包含真实项目实战和前后端协同开发环节。

